A Lifting Based Approach to Observer Based Fault Detection of Linear Periodic Systems

In this note, an approach based on lifting is introduced for the observer based fault detection (FD) of linear discrete-time periodic systems. The main contribution of this note is to give an analytic expression to transform the linear time-invariant (LTI) observer based residual generator designed based on the lifted LTI reformulation of the periodic system into a periodic observer based residual generator to reduce detection delay. The result enables a systematic transfer of the existing observer based FD methods for discrete LTI systems to discrete-time periodic systems.
